If you want REALLY cheap, buy someones old stock shocks. If you only have a little money, decide what you are going to use the car for and buy a "good" set of that type or you will be buying and changing forever.
As far as one type covers it all, expect to pay a lot or compromise a lot. A lot means $2000 or more and there are many "great" options here. JIC, Tein, DMS, Ohlin, Koni, etc are just a few and it seems there are more all the time. If you just want "poser" struts (just street
then the Progress, AGX, ... are good. Flame suit on!
